Portland, OR - The Tall Buildings is a side project of Stranger Lazy. Crafted and created from the mind of Kevin Fitzpatrick, the music of The Tall Buildings ranges from vastly consuming to hauntingly isolated. The first album "Rare, Priceless Discoveries!" is a mix of 80's sounding beats (provided by Ben Messer's vintage keyboard that he gave me) and modern day themes of self awareness and exploration. Enjoy the moods, tunes and spherical cosmic shapes!

Recorded in Portland, OR / Bloomington, IN / Washington D.C. - 2008, during the rainy season.
